GCC Viral Clearance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the GCC viral clearance market Size was estimated at 17.6 USD Million in 2024. The GCC viral clearance market is projected to grow from 21.47 USD Million in 2025 to 156.87 USD Million by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 22%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Viral Removal Method (Dominant) vs. Viral Inactivation Method (Emerging)

The Viral Removal Method is currently the dominant player in the GCC viral clearance market due to its established effectiveness and regulatory acceptance. This method employs various physical and chemical processes to eliminate viral contaminants, making it a critical component in the production of safe medicinal products. Its widespread usage in major biopharmaceutical companies ensures its market supremacy. On the other hand, the Viral Inactivation Method is an emerging alternative, gaining popularity due to its efficiency and ability to deactivate viruses rather than removing them entirely. This method offers a promising improvement in workflow and product yield, making it attractive for modern biomanufacturing processes, thus carving a niche within the market.

Industry Developments

The GCC Viral Clearance Market has seen significant developments lately, with a focus on enhancing safety protocols in biopharmaceutical manufacturing. Notably, companies like Sartorius and Merck KGaA have made substantial investments in improving their viral clearance technologies to meet stringent regulatory requirements in the region. In August 2023, Thermo Fisher Scientific announced the expansion of its facilities in the UAE to boost its capabilities in viral clearance testing, addressing the region's growing demand for viral safety in biologics.

The market has experienced a robust growth valuation, partly driven by rising collaborations among key players like Charles River Laboratories and Fujifilm Diosynth Biotechnologies. 

Additionally, public information from July 2023 indicated that WuXi AppTec has enhanced its service offerings to cater specifically to GCC biopharma stakeholders, broadening its market reach. Over the past few years, the strategic partnership between BioRad Laboratories and Pall Corporation, initiated in May 2022, has strengthened their operational synergies in the GCC. These trends suggest a burgeoning market landscape underscored by innovation and regional collaboration among leading firms in the viral clearance sector.
